Construction Accounting: Full Guide for Contractors 2024
It includes recognizing revenue and costs based on the stage of completion, managing variations and claims, and ensuring transparent financial reporting specific to construction projects. Job costing is a cornerstone of construction accounting, involving the precise allocation of expenses to specific construction projects. ITIN documentation frequently asked questions FAQs Internal Revenue Service
To apply for an ITIN, complete IRS Form W-7, IRS Application for Individual Taxpayer Identification Number. Form W-7 requires documentation substantiating foreign/alien status and true identity for each individual.
